I did a 5-week flexible search for LAX to JFK, one-way, using miles, non-stop only. January 2018 (because that was the date I was looking at for something else) is mostly 15K.

Picking a few other months at random:

August 2017: 44K the first week, 27K the weeks after that, and scatted 15K and 18.5K at the end of the month

October 2017: almost all 15K

but per the OP the 15Ks may be red-eyes only or something, didn't dig futher.
